			            Original DescriptionBathed in luminous golden hues, Sunset at Sea by Martin Johnson Heade (1819–1904) captures nature’s poetic grandeur through a masterful interplay of light and atmosphere. This late 19th-century work exemplifies Heade’s signature Luminist style—a distinctly American movement emphasizing serene landscapes, meticulous detail, and radiant light effects. Unlike his contemporaries in the Hudson River School, Heade focused on intimate, meditative scenes, often depicting coastal sunsets that evoke tranquility and spiritual awe. Painted during his Florida period, the piece reflects his fascination with the interplay of sky and sea, rendered in translucent layers of color and soft, diffused horizons. Despite his relative obscurity during his lifetime, Heade’s contributions to American art are now celebrated, with Sunset at Sea standing as a testament to his ability to transform fleeting natural moments into timeless visual poetry. Today, his works are prized in major collections like the Metropolitan Museum of Art, bridging Romanticism and the ethereal qualities of early modernism.
